How to fill out substantial protocol amendments

How to fill out substantial protocol amendments:
01
Start by reviewing the original protocol carefully. Understand the purpose, objectives, and procedures mentioned in the protocol.
02
Identify the areas that need to be amended or revised in the protocol. This could include changes in study design, sample size, inclusion/exclusion criteria, data collection methods, or any other relevant aspects.
03
Clearly state the reason for each proposed amendment. Provide a comprehensive explanation of why the amendment is necessary and how it will improve the study or address any identified issues.
04
Ensure that the proposed amendments are in compliance with ethical guidelines, regulatory requirements, and institutional policies. Make sure that the amendment does not compromise participant safety or welfare.
05
Consult with the appropriate stakeholders, such as the principal investigator, co-investigators, research coordinators, or ethics committee members, to review and discuss the proposed amendments. Their input and feedback can help refine the amendments and make them more effective.
06
Once the amendments have been finalized, use the appropriate protocol amendment form provided by the regulatory authority or institution. Fill out the form accurately and completely, providing all the necessary information, such as the study title, protocol number, date of amendment, etc.
07
Attach any supporting documents or additional information that may be required, such as updated study documents, revised informed consent forms, or data collection tools.
08
Submit the completed protocol amendment form along with all supporting documents to the appropriate authority or ethics committee for review and approval. Follow any specific submission guidelines or requirements.
09
After submission, await feedback and response from the authority or committee. If any modifications or revisions are requested, address them promptly and resubmit the amended protocol for further review.
10
Once the protocol amendments have been approved, implement the changes in the study conduct accordingly. Communicate the approved amendments to all relevant team members and ensure that everyone is aware of the modifications.
Who needs substantial protocol amendments?
01
Researchers conducting clinical trials or any other research studies may need substantial protocol amendments. These amendments are necessary when there is a need to modify the original study design, methods, or objectives.
02
Ethical review boards and regulatory authorities require researchers to submit substantial protocol amendments for approval. This ensures that any changes made to the study are reviewed to maintain participant safety, ethical considerations, and adherence to regulatory guidelines.
03
Sponsors funding the research may also be involved in the decision-making process regarding substantial protocol amendments. They have a vested interest in ensuring the study's objectives are met and any modifications are in line with the study's purpose and goals.

What is substantial protocol amendments?
Substantial protocol amendments are changes made to a research protocol that could affect the conduct of the study or the safety of participants.
Who is required to file substantial protocol amendments?
The principal investigator or sponsor is typically required to file substantial protocol amendments.
How to fill out substantial protocol amendments?
Substantial protocol amendments can be filled out by providing detailed information about the changes made to the protocol and submitting the amended document to the relevant ethics committee or regulatory authority.
What is the purpose of substantial protocol amendments?
The purpose of substantial protocol amendments is to ensure that changes to the research protocol are reviewed and approved to protect the safety and rights of study participants and maintain the scientific integrity of the study.
What information must be reported on substantial protocol amendments?
The information reported on substantial protocol amendments typically includes a description of the changes made, rationale for the changes, potential impact on participants, and any updated study documents.
